An Adventure in Silverbell Forest

In the heart of the small and quiet town of Willowpeak, where the hills kiss the violet sky, lived a young and audacious boy named Ethan. Ethan was unlike other boys of his age. While his peers spent their time fishing at the lake or exploring the meadows, Ethan found solace and thrill between the pages of fairy tales and fables. He had an inexhaustible curiosity for mythical creatures, ancient spells, and enchanted artifacts. But most of all, he was captivated by the stories surrounding the Silverbell Forest, a place he often gazed upon from his bedroom window.
Almost everyone in Willowpeak had heard of the tales associated with the Silverbell Forest. It was told that a mystical creature resided in the heart of the forest, guarding a well-hidden treasure. However, the identity of the creature and the nature of the treasure remained shrouded in mystery, as no one from Willowpeak had ventured deep enough into the forest to uncover them.
Drunk on his insatiable sense of adventure, Ethan decided to unravel this mystery. Armed with a compass, a bag of provisions, and a heart full of courage, the young explorer ventured courageously into the Silverbell forest.
The forest was indeed as magical as the stories painted it. It was a sea of shimmering leaves, enchanting tweets of unseen birds, and floral fragrances strong enough to lull anyone into a dreamy daze. But the allure of the forest did not distract Ethan from his goal.
After days of navigating through the dense canopy and marshy grounds, Ethan finally discovered what he had been seeking. There, under a majestic tree was a magnificent dragon, its scales glittering in the limited sunlight that penetrated the forest cover. From the dragon's nostrils, whiffs of smoke trailed up into the canopy, creating a halo of haze around the creature.
Ethan watched in awe and fear as he realized the treasure the dragon was guarding – a magnificent chest carved out of gold, adorned with precious jewels that gleamed even in the dim light. Ethan gathered all the courage he could muster and slowly approached the dragon, who rumbled a warning growl, billowing smoke from his nostrils.
Instead of stepping back as any sane person would, Ethan reached into his pocket and pulled out a flute. It was said in the tales that music had a calming effect on the mystical creatures. Holding his breath, he put the flute to his lips and began to play a soft, soothing melody that echoed through the forest.
To Ethan’s surprise, the dragon's fiery eyes softened, its gaze fixated on Ethan. As the dragon's guard dropped, Ethan moved slowly towards the golden chest. The dragon merely watched him, seemingly mesmerized by the music. The boy kept playing until he reached the chest and on opening it, found an ancient scroll.
The scroll revealed the true treasure of the Silverbell Forest - the secret to communicating with the animals and plants, a language lost to time and civilization. Ethan realized he had found a bridge between mankind and the natural world, an ability to coexist and thrive.
Returning to Willowpeak, Ethan brought back a different story, a different treasure. He shared the ancient language with his people, forever changing their relationship with the fauna and flora around them. From then on, Willowpeak existed in harmony with nature, living out their own fairy tale within the Silverbell Forest.
Remembered as a hero, Ethan didn’t uncover just a treasure for his people, but also unearthed a profound understanding of life – true treasure isn’t always gold and gems, sometimes it’s just the simple harmony between man and nature.
